Understanding the "Rename Folder Error"

Before diving into solutions, let's understand what might cause this error. The error message itself is quite generic, and the underlying cause can be one of several issues:

  • File Access Permissions: You might lack the necessary permissions to rename a folder. This is common when working with system folders or folders owned by other users.
  • File in Use: The folder or files within the folder might be currently in use by another program or process. This prevents the operating system from renaming it.
  • Disk Errors: A problem with your hard drive or storage device could be preventing the renaming operation. Bad sectors or corrupted file system metadata can cause this.
  • Antivirus Interference: Sometimes, overzealous antivirus software can interfere with file system operations, leading to renaming errors.
  • Insufficient Disk Space: While less common, a lack of available disk space can sometimes prevent file system operations like renaming.
  • Conflicting File Names: Attempting to rename a folder to a name that already exists in the same directory will also result in an error.
  • Long File Names: Extremely long file or folder names can sometimes exceed the operating system's limitations, leading to errors.

Troubleshooting and Solutions

Here’s a step-by-step approach to resolving rename folder errors:

1. Close Conflicting Programs:

  • Identify Running Processes: Check your Task Manager (Windows) or Activity Monitor (macOS) to identify any programs that might be accessing the folder you're trying to rename. Close these programs before attempting the rename again.

2. Check File Permissions:

  • Administrative Privileges: Try renaming the folder while running your computer with administrator privileges. This grants the necessary permissions to access and modify system files.

3. Restart Your Computer:

  • A simple reboot can often resolve temporary glitches that interfere with file system operations.

4. Run a Disk Check:

  • Windows: Open Command Prompt as administrator and type chkdsk C: /f /r (replace C: with your system drive letter) and press Enter. This checks your hard drive for errors and attempts to fix them.
  • macOS: Use Disk Utility to run a First Aid check on your startup disk.

5. Temporarily Disable Antivirus:

  • If you suspect your antivirus software is causing the problem, temporarily disable it and try renaming the folder. Re-enable it afterward.

6. Check Disk Space:

  • Ensure you have sufficient free space on your hard drive. If your disk is almost full, try deleting unnecessary files to free up space.

7. Rename via Command Prompt or Terminal:

  • Using the command line can sometimes bypass issues encountered using the graphical interface. In Windows, use ren "old_folder_name" "new_folder_name", and in macOS, use mv "old_folder_name" "new_folder_name". Be sure to use the correct path to the folder.

8. Use a Different Folder Name:

  • Try using a shorter and simpler folder name. Avoid special characters or spaces if possible.

Prevention Strategies

To minimize future occurrences of rename folder errors, consider these preventative measures:

  • Regular Disk Maintenance: Regularly run disk checks and defragment your hard drive (Windows) to maintain optimal performance and prevent file system corruption.
  • Careful File Management: Organize your files effectively to avoid creating excessively long file paths or deeply nested folders.
  • Regular Software Updates: Keep your operating system and antivirus software updated to benefit from the latest bug fixes and security patches.
